Technical Considerations for Designers

Before integrating this digital product into a client project, there are several technical checks every designer must perform. The purchase includes an SVG file ready to import into any design program, a DXF file for cutting machines, and a PNG with high-resolution detail.

  1. Vector Editability: Inspect the SVG code if possible. Ensure that the paths are simplified and not overly complex. Complex nodes can cause issues when scaling or when sending files to commercial printers. A clean vector structure is essential for maintaining sharp edges at any size.
  2. Contrast Testing: Preview the design on both light and dark backgrounds. Zombie themes often rely on shadows or specific color palettes (like greens or grays). Verify that these colors maintain sufficient contrast against your chosen background to preserve readability.
  3. Font Pairing: If you plan to add typography, compare the illustration’s style with serif font, sans serif font, script font, handwritten font, and display font options. A bold sans-serif font usually complements this type of graphic best, reinforcing the modern, punchy feel. Avoid delicate scripts that might clash with the rugged zombie aesthetic.
  4. Print Quality: Always test print a small section. Check how the ink lays down on different materials. For sublimation designs, ensure the colors translate accurately to polyester blends.
